Payfi

3.9 ยท 8 reviews
B
Banessa Watson
Reviews 1
2023-11-24 22:43

I've been using an online payment platform recentl...

I've been using an online payment platform recently, and it has been a positive experience. The platform is easy to use, and the transactions are quick and secure. I would recommend it to others looking for a reliable payment solution.

Read full review

View all reviews on Trustburn